About 4-methyl-5H-pyrrolo[3,2-c]pyridazine

4-methyl-5H-pyrrolo[3,2-c]pyridazine (PubChem CID 58957234) has the molecular formula C7H7N3 and a molecular weight of 133.15 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-methyl-5H-pyrrolo[3,2-c]pyridazine.
